Valve, a Microsoft firm
One of many greatest headlines to spawn from the leak was the truth that Phil Spencer actually wished to purchase Nintendo at one level in 2020, calling it a possible “profession second” for himself. We already knew that Microsoft was excited about buying Sega and a handful of different main recreation studios — together with ZeniMax, which it efficiently acquired in 2021, and Activision-Blizzard, which is the explanation we’re studying these inside messages within the first place. The leaked emails reveal further companies that Xbox wished to gobble up, together with Warner Bros. Interactive, Valve and TikTok.
“Our BoD has seen the total writeup on Nintendo (and Valve) and they’re totally supportive on both if alternative arises as am I,” Spencer wrote.
Warner Bros. Interactive makes a modicum of sense right here, however Valve feels as out-of-reach as Nintendo by way of a possible acquisition. Valve is a non-public firm and it does not publicly share monetary information, however one in all Xbox’s slides estimated its 2021 income complete at $7 billion, about the identical as Digital Arts or Activision-Blizzard. However greater than profitability, Valve has a secure place because the main distributor of PC video games by way of Steam, and it could be fully out-of-character for the corporate to entertain a buyout.
This entire electronic mail thread began as a result of Microsoft Industrial Chief Advertising Officer Takeshi Numoto despatched an electronic mail to Spencer with the topic line, “random thought.” In it, Numoto expressed confusion over inside discussions to buy TikTok, suggesting Nintendo as a greater possibility. Neither of those purchases occurred, after all.
Mark Cerny talks an excessive amount of
Sony unveiled the primary particulars concerning the PlayStation 5 on March 18, 2020, and Microsoft executives mentioned the specs that very same day in an electronic mail chain. The preliminary breakdown included commentary about PS5 architect Mark Cerny’s presentation, full with the strains, “Cerny talked at size concerning the transfer to SSDs,” and, “Cerny additionally spent what appeared like a disproportionate period of time on audio improvements.” In an in any other case sterile, fully skilled electronic mail, these strains may as properly have been direct insults about Cerny’s lineage.
Spencer shared his abstract of the PS5’s capabilities with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ella that very same day, concluding with, “This was a great day for Xbox.”

King King
That is your repeatedly scheduled reminder that Microsoft’s try to accumulate Activision-Blizzard is definitely all about King, the cellular developer behind Sweet Crush. Though “King” is commonly omitted of the Activision-Blizzard moniker solely, this studio persistently brings in probably the most cash of any phase.
This is how Spencer put it in an electronic mail on January 28, 2020, earlier than acquisition talks started: “Activision is exclusive associate given their King acquisition. Q3 income for King was $500M (all cellular) whereas Activision (Name of Obligation) was $209M and Blizzard $394M (leaning PC but in addition contains cellular and console). Activision is mostly a cellular first writer (by way of their $6B King acquisition).”
Simply one thing to bear in mind because the Microsoft-Activision acquisition continues to play out in courtroom.

ZeniMax’s gross sales pitch
Microsoft’s monetary yr ends and begins in July, which makes this chart from 2020 even tougher to digest. That is how ZeniMax offered its launch calendar to Microsoft throughout acquisition negotiations, and it begins with Starfield popping out by summer time 2021, adopted by Bethesda’s Indiana Jones recreation by summer time 2022, Doom Yr Zero by summer time 2023 and Elder Scrolls VI and Dishonored 3 by summer time 2024. Surely, Starfield got here out this literal month, and we have heard little or no — or nothing in any respect — about Indiana Jones, Elder Scrolls VI or Dishonored 3. Elder Scrolls VI probably is not popping out for 5 extra years, actually. And also you thought you have been bummed out by main recreation delays.
